Solve.A basketball fieldhouse seats 15,000. Courtside seats sell for $10, endzone for $7, and balcony for $4. The total revenue from a sell-out is $84,000. If half the courtside and balcony seats and all the endzone seats are sold, the total revenue is $49,000. How many of each type are there?
A. 3200 courtside; 1800 endzone; 10,000 balcony
B. 3000 courtside; 2000 endzone; 10,000 balcony
C. 4000 courtside; 3000 endzone; 8000 balcony
D. 3000 courtside; 3000 endzone; 8,000 balcony
Answer: B
